Europe Angry over Iran's Hostility Towards Israel

Iran's president Mahmoud Ahmadinejad stated on Wednesday that the state of Israel should "be wiped off the map." European Union leaders along with other countries including the U.S. and Canada condemn the president for saying such harsh words. European leaders stated Thursday that "Calls for violence, and for the destruction of any state, are manifestly inconsistent with any claim to be a mature and responsible member of the international community." The main concern held by European leaders and officials is over Iran's intentions to target surrounding countries with nuclear arms.
